I live for happy moments like these! Austin contacted me from Texas a couple of weeks before a planned trip to Colorado with his sweetie. He planned to propose and wanted the big moment captured for posterity. We did a little scheming on the sly and determined that the Garden of the Gods overlook on Mesa would be the best spot. On the big day my second photographer Joy and I posed as tourists, and when Austin and Katie arrived, we positioned ourselves a few yards behind them. I’m sure Katie thought we were the weirdest tourists ever as she could feel us lurking behind the bushes as they admired the view for what felt like an eternity. But then… suddenly Austin got down on one knee and popped the question! Of course her response was an enthusiastic YES, then she dropped to her knees to embrace him. A couple of ladies in the parking lot above us witnessed the whole thing and cheered loudly. It was a wonderful moment! ❤ Afterward we went to the Garden of the Gods to snap a few happy official portraits. Congratulations to Katie and Austin! Check out Liz and Michael’s sweet Broomfield elopement! Certainly eloping is not what they originally planned on doing, but world events dictated a change in direction. By necessity, all of the weddings I had booked for this year have either been postponed, drastically scaled down, or a combination of both. Liz and Michael’s wedding in Golden had been scheduled for September, with family and friends coming from all corners of the country. The pandemic put the kibosh on that plan, at least temporarily, but that didn’t stop them from tying the knot! They decided to simply elope in Broomfield, then have the big party whenever it becomes possible for them to do it. The only witness at their elopement was me — there wasn’t even an officiant, they simply exchanged rings and sealed it with a kiss. Love it! I felt really honored to be able to document this. Since no one in their families could come, I think it was extra important to get great pictures of their big moment. Congratulations Michael and Liz! ❤
